What are the typical daily responsibilities of an employee at an Adidas Distribution Center?

At an Adidas Distribution Center, employees are typically responsible for tasks such as receiving and processing incoming shipments, picking and packing orders, operating warehouse equipment like forklifts or pallet jacks, and ensuring inventory accuracy through regular stock checks. Team members often work collaboratively to meet shipping deadlines and maintain safety standards. The role is fast-paced and physically active, requiring attention to detail and effective communication with supervisors and colleagues.

What is an Adidas Distribution Center?

An Adidas Distribution Center is a large warehouse facility where Adidas products are received, stored, sorted, and shipped to retailers, online customers, and other distribution points. These centers play a crucial role in the supply chain by ensuring that Adidas merchandise is efficiently handled and delivered on time. Employees at these centers are responsible for tasks such as inventory management, order picking, packing, and shipping, often using advanced technology and logistics systems. Working at an Adidas Distribution Center usually involves teamwork, attention to detail, and meeting performance targets to support the brand's global operations.

Job description

The Senior Operations Manager will be supporting mid-shift operations (12pm-8pm).  

This role is primarily aligned to a 12:00 PM – 8:00 PM schedule; however, we offer flexibility with start times (e.g., 1:00 PM – 9:00 PM or 2:00 PM – 10:00 PM) to support both business needs and individual preferences.

PURPOSE
The Senior Operations Manager is a key leader within the adidas North American Supply Chain organization, responsible for managing operations for our ecommerce and retail Distribution Center. This role ensures productivity and service level targets are achieved while driving continuous improvement initiatives that enhance efficiency and reduce costs. You will have the opportunity to make a significant impact on adidas’ fastest-growing channels and help shape the future of our supply chain.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Lead all Distribution Center operations to achieve productivity, service level, and quality targets.
  • Develop and manage the annual budget and cost per unit for the Distribution Center.
  • Drive strategic initiatives to improve cost structure and customer experience.
  • Maintain expertise in WCS and WMS platforms, providing guidance and support to operations and IT teams.
  • Report on operational metrics to evaluate performance in productivity, quality, safety, and service levels.

KEY RELATIONSHIPS
Distribution Directors, Transportation, Finance, Customs, and Distribution Center leadership teams.

KNOWLEDGE SKILLS AND ABILITIES

  • Experience leading high-volume ecommerce operations with direct ownership of consumer experience.
  • Strong analytical and data management skills with proficiency in Microsoft Office and advanced Excel.
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to interact effectively across all organizational levels.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of supply chain technology solutions and end-to-end processes.
  • Proven ability to manage budgets and deliver results in a dynamic environment.

REQUISITE E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Bachelor’s degree required; advanced degree preferred. Minimum of seven years of relevant experience in operations or supply chain management.
